
A homeowner in Stokesdale, North Carolina wanted a unique water-focused outdoor space where a pond and saltwater pool would appear visually connected from the lake. The design used waterfalls, an infinity-edge pool, natural stone elements, and lake-inspired landscaping to create the illusion of one continuous body of water.
The Client's Vision:
As longtime clients and self-described "pond people," they envisioned creating a truly unique outdoor experience centered on water. The goal was to establish a dramatic focal point where a new pond-and-pool combination would appear visually connected from the lake, blurring the lines between the two separate water features (natural pond water and a saltwater pool).

Our Design Solution:
Our approach was 'Pond Centric' from the start. Although a site constraint (a pre-approved septic field location) required us to move the primary water feature from the initial front entrance concept to the rear of the property, the topography of this amazing lake lot—perched on a pinnacle—allowed for a breathtaking re-design.
